]]></description></item><item><title>How&amp;nbsp;to&amp;nbsp;write&amp;nbsp;a&amp;nbsp;short&amp;nbsp;email?Examples&amp;nbsp;from&amp;nbsp;the&amp;nbsp;real&amp;nbsp;world.</title><link>http://rainlane.com/dispbbs.asp?BoardID=8&amp;ID=11969&amp;Page=1</link><author>Foothill</author><pubDate>2004-9-9 4:28:52</pubDate><description><![CDATA[Most emails are short and simple.  But how sentences can be shortened is a tricky thing.  Posted below is a real email.  If people here are interested, I will post more examples.<br/><br/>Example 1: Returning a book<br/><br/>Hi Edward,<br/>
	<br/>Hope your summer was fruitful...<br/>
	<br/>I just got back from staying in Texas all summer.  Whenever you're in office can you drop off the SAS manual?  If I'm not in just have it put in my mailbox.<br/>
	<br/>Thanks<br/>
	<br/>Miles<br/><br/>Comments:<br/>- Fruitful is not a word I use a lot, but obviously it is ok to be used this way.<br/><br/>- I just got back from staying in Texas all summer. ==&gt;I just came back from Texas, where I stayed all summer.<br/><br/>- have it put in my mailbox: Since Edward does not have access to Miles' mailbox, he has to ask Miles' secretary to put the manual in Miles' mailbox.<br/><br/><br/><br/><br/><br/><br/><div align="right"><font color="#000066">[此贴子已经被Yeti于2004-9-13 13:54:19编辑过]</font></div><br/>]]></description></item></channel></rss>
